MP Backs Small Breweries in Campaign to Save Local Pubs

Brentwood and Ongar MP Alex Burghart is championing a proposal to allow tenanted pubs to serve guest beers from small breweries, a move he says would support local businesses and encourage more people to visit their local pub.

The MP, who has been running a campaign urging constituents to drink a pint a week in their local pub, visited the Brentwood Brewing Company last week. There, he met with a representative from SIBA, the Society of Independent Brewers, who outlined the challenges facing small breweries.

Challenges Facing Small Breweries

According to the SIBA representative, small breweries often struggle to sell their beers because tenanted landlords are bound by agreements that exclude all but the largest producers from their taps. In free houses, large producers can lock landlords into exclusive purchasing agreements, further limiting access for smaller brewers.

The proposal, which Burghart plans to send to the minister, would change regulations to allow tenanted pubs to offer a guest beer alongside those from larger producers. Burghart described the idea as "good for small and local businesses" and a way to attract more customers to pubs.

Support for Local Breweries

Burghart highlighted that the profit on a pint is minimal once alcohol duty, taxes, and import costs are accounted for, making support for the industry crucial. He noted that the pub industry faces some of the harshest tax and regulation of any businesses worldwide.

The MP's campaign has taken him to many pubs across the constituency, where landlords have shared similar stories about the difficulties of operating in the current climate.

Next Steps

Burghart will forward the proposals to the minister and continue his tour of local pubs, with the hope that they will soon all be serving a locally brewed pint. He reiterated his call for residents to support their local pubs by drinking a pint a week.
